I applied online. The process took 6 weeks. I interviewed at Hilti North America (Minneapolis, MN) in Jul 2016
Interview
Long, poorly structured, Application, phone interview, Face to face, Ride along.
I was asked to take a day (from my current role) and work in the field with a current hilti sales rep only to find out from that same rep that he was never contacted for a follow-up and the role had been filled the week previously.
This is the worst kind of mid level management ineptitude and at the very least a gross lack of basic professionalism. Not to mention a waste of my time and money.
Additionally, they provided zero feedback, again, a serious lack of professionalism.
I applied through a recruiter.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at Hilti North America (Toronto, ON) in Oct 2015
Interview
Lengthy and thorough 7 interview process, phone and in person. I was persued by a recruiter, interviewed on the phone, via Skype, then flown to the head office to interview with Sr. Management.
